CBOT September wheat (WU26) may retrace to $6.06-1/2 per bushel, following its failure to break resistance at $6.14-1/4.

Both a retracement analysis and a trendline suggest a further correction toward $6.06-1/2. The bearish divergence on the hourly RSI may be discounted more as well.

A break above $6.14-1/4 could lead to a gain into $6.19-1/2 to $6.26-3/4 range. On the daily chart, a projection analysis reveals a resistance at $6.17-1/4, which is working with the one at $6.14-1/4 (hourly chart) to stop the rise.

A five-wave cycle from $7.00 might have ended. The peak of the wave 4 around $6.25-1/4 serves as a target. Based on this reading, the subsequent correction could be shallow, to be followed by a resumption of the rise toward $6.25-1/4.
